Which Way Does Crush Washer Go On Oil Plug Subaru. Subaru uses a copper washer on the outback and legacy (at least on my 01' outback, 94' legacy). If you torque the drain plug properly by slapping the wrench a. So the most important question about your car… which way around does the crush washer go on a drain plug? The rounded side of the crush washer needs to go on the side with the irregularities , in this case its the oil pan. This can also be seen in the spark plugs, for example.
